Make Your Own Driftwood Christmas Tree

2:23 PM By Alana Shinn 1 Comment

Driftwood-Christmas-Tree-pin

Ever thought of ditching the traditional Christmas tree for something a little more unique?

Well this project is for you. Alana, from the DIY blog Threadbare Cloak, gives us the low down on how to make our very own driftwood Christmas tree.

It looks stunning either decorated or left plain, costs next to nothing and is really easy to make.

The hardest part is collecting the driftwood from the beach!
